NAPC found UAH 29 million worth of unsubstantiated assets from Verbitsky

The National Agency for the Prevention of Corruption identified signs of a criminal corruption offense in the actions of the former Deputy Prosecutor General of Ukraine Dmitry Verbitsky, indicating illegal enrichment of almost 29 million hryvnia.

“The National Agency for the Prevention of Corruption (NACP), during lifestyle monitoring, identified signs of a corruption criminal offense in the actions of the former Deputy Prosecutor General of Ukraine, indicating his illegal enrichment of almost 29 million UAH,” the report says.

In particular, the NACP established that, on behalf of the employee, persons associated with him acquired the following unjustified assets:

  • Lexus ES 300H car worth more than 960 thousand UAH;
  • Lexus NX 300H car worth more than 480 thousand UAH;
  • a Porsche Macan T worth UAH 3.5 million;
  • house and land in Kyiv worth UAH 16.3 million;
  • house and land in Odessa worth 10 million UAH;

apartment and land plot in Antalya (Türkiye) worth UAH 3.9 million.

At the same time, according to the NACP, the legal sources of origin of the employee’s cash worth more than UAH 2 million, as well as the Tether (USDT) cryptocurrency, have not been established.

The department notes that the materials regarding the former Deputy Prosecutor General have been sent to the National Anti-Corruption Bureau of Ukraine for joining them with the materials of criminal proceedings and conducting a pre-trial investigation.

In May, Schemes journalists found out that Deputy Prosecutor General of Ukraine Dmitry Verbitsky lives in the elite Kiev cottage town of Konik, where his nephew bought a house at a price six times less than the market value.

Verbitsky, answering the question from “Schemes,” claimed that he only knew the price specified in the contract for this property. When asked about the possibility of tax evasion due to the fact that his nephew purchased real estate at a price significantly below the market price, Verbitsky defended the deal, pointing to defects in the house and the “need for additional financial investments” in it.

Journalists also found that Verbitsky’s girlfriend received luxury property worth at least UAH 52 million in 2024, without having sufficient official income of her own for this.

On July 1, Prosecutor General Andrei Kostin signed an order for the voluntary dismissal of his deputy Dmitry Verbitsky from the administrative post.

Verbitsky stated that he wrote a letter of resignation in order to avoid a negative impact on the work of the department as a whole. According to the ex-official, this decision is justified by the fact that negative information in the media that concerns him also affects the image of the prosecutor's office as a whole.
